Private Mental Health Assessment Costs in the UK: A Complete Guide

Psychological health has actually become a progressively essential topic in public discourse, and many individuals in the United Kingdom are exploring their choices for professional assessment and assistance. While the National Health Service provides excellent psychological health services, waiting times can often be prolonged, triggering people to consider personal options. Understanding the costs related to personal mental health assessments is vital for making notified decisions about your psychological health and wellbeing.

Why People Choose Private Mental Health Assessments

The decision to pursue a private psychological health assessment frequently stems from practical issues about ease of access and timing. NHS psychological health services, while detailed and free at the point of usage, regularly involve waiting durations that can extend from several weeks to several months depending on area and the specific service required. For individuals experiencing substantial distress or those whose everyday performance is affected by mental health symptoms, these waits can feel intolerable.

Private assessments offer an alternative pathway that generally offers much quicker access to expert assessment. Numerous personal practitioners can arrange preliminary assessments within days rather than weeks, enabling individuals to start understanding and resolving their issues quickly. Furthermore, private services frequently use higher versatility in scheduling appointments, with options consisting of night and weekend accessibility that accommodate hectic work schedules or caregiving obligations.

Beyond timing considerations, some people choose the extra privacy and discretion that private services can supply. Others might wish to select their specialist based upon particular expertises or restorative approaches, rather than being appointed to whichever professional happens to be available through NHS services.

What a Private Mental Health Assessment Typically Includes

A thorough personal mental health assessment typically involves several elements created to build a total image of a person's psychological state and needs. The procedure typically starts with a preliminary assessment, during which the professional gathers in-depth details about the individual's current signs, personal history, and presenting issues.

This intake interview normally explores family background, medical history, injury or significant life events, substance usage, and the impact of existing symptoms on everyday performance. Practitioners also examine any previous psychological health treatment and its efficiency. The assessment may consist of standardised questionnaires and score scales that assist measure symptoms and offer benchmarks for measuring progress.

Following the initial assessment, specialists typically conduct psychological testing appropriate to the presenting issues. These might include cognitive assessments, personality stocks, or particular screening tools for conditions such as depression, stress and anxiety, bipolar disorder, or ADHD. The assessment concludes with a feedback session where the specialist discusses their findings, offers diagnostic impressions if applicable, and lays out suggestions for treatment.

Expense Breakdown of Private Mental Health Assessments

Private mental health assessment costs in the UK vary significantly based upon several aspects, including the kind of practitioner, the intricacy of the assessment, and geographical place. The following table supplies a basic overview of common expenses for various assessment types:

Assessment TypeTypical Cost RangePeriodPreliminary Consultation₤ 150 - ₤ 30060-90 minutesBasic Psychological Assessment₤ 300 - ₤ 6002-4 hours totalComprehensive Psychiatric Assessment₤ 250 - ₤ 50060-90 minutesADHD Assessment (Adult)₤ 400 - ₤ 9003-6 hours totalAutism Spectrum Assessment (Adult)₤ 500 - ₤ 1,2006-10 hours overallNeuropsychological Assessment₤ 800 - ₤ 1,5008-16 hours total

Expenses can also differ significantly by region, with practitioners in London and the South East normally charging greater rates than those in other parts of the country. The following table shows common regional variations:

RegionPreliminary ConsultationComprehensive AssessmentLondon₤ 200 - ₤ 350₤ 500 - ₤ 800South East (leaving out London)₤ 175 - ₤ 275₤ 400 - ₤ 650Midlands and North England₤ 150 - ₤ 250₤ 350 - ₤ 550Scotland and Wales₤ 150 - ₤ 250₤ 350 - ₤ 550

Factors That Influence Pricing

Comprehending what drives the variation in personal psychological health assessment costs helps individuals make more informed options about where to seek services. The level of professional know-how represents one of the most significant expense aspects. Evaluations performed by specialist psychiatrists, who hold medical degrees and professional training, generally cost more than those carried out by medical psychologists, counselling psychologists, or mental health nurses. This shows the different levels of training required and the additional medical know-how that psychiatrists bring to intricate cases.

The depth and complexity of the assessment likewise impact pricing considerably. A simple assessment for a clear presenting issue requires less practitioner time and less professional resources than a complicated evaluation including comprehensive psychological testing, security details event, and comprehensive differential diagnosis. Assessments for conditions such as ADHD or autism spectrum disorder typically include several sessions, standard ranking scales finished by member of the family or partners, and detailed report writing, all of which add to higher expenses.

Report composing should have particular mention as a cost factor. The composed report synthesising assessment findings, offering diagnostic solution, and offering treatment recommendations represents a significant quantity of professional work that professionals must factor into their costs. Some professionals price quote costs that include the report, while others charge individually for this component.

Extra Costs to Consider

When budgeting for a private mental health assessment, people need to represent several prospective extra costs beyond the core assessment cost. Follow-up consultations to go over outcomes and treatment preparation generally sustain different charges, typically ranging from ₤ 100 to ₤ 200 per session. These sessions are essential for understanding assessment findings and creating a meaningful treatment strategy.

Medication, if recommended following psychiatric assessment, involves extra costs. While the medication itself is usually offered at standard NHS prescription charges in England (presently ₤ 9.90 per item, though exemptions use), some people choose to have prescriptions given independently, which can often be more pricey. People living in Scotland, Wales, or Northern Ireland do not pay prescription charges, reducing this cost.

Some specialists need payment upfront, while others offer payment plans for bigger evaluations. Comprehending a professional's payment policies before committing to an assessment helps avoid financial stress.

Does Health Insurance Cover Private Assessments?

Personal health insurance coverage offers coverage for psychological health assessments and treatment, though the level of coverage differs substantially in between policies. Detailed health insurance policies usually cover psychiatric assessments and subsequent treatment, subject to policy limitations and excess plans. However, lots of policies enforce caps on the variety of treatment sessions covered each year or location monetary limitations on mental health claims.

Individuals thinking about private assessment needs to contact their insurance provider before reserving to validate coverage. Comprehending policy exclusions, pre-authorisation requirements, and any suitable excesses helps avoid unforeseen expenditures. Some insurance providers need referral from a GP before authorizing protection for private psychological health services, including another action to the process.

Finding Affordable Options

Numerous strategies can help individuals gain access to private psychological health evaluations at more workable costs. Some specialists offer decreased rates for trainees, people on low incomes, or those experiencing monetary difficulty. These sliding-scale plans need evidence of income or scenarios however can significantly lower costs for eligible individuals.

University psychology departments sometimes supply inexpensive assessments performed by student professionals under clinical guidance. These assessments take longer however provide substantial expense savings. Similarly, some charitable organisations concentrated on specific conditions offer assessment services at minimized rates or totally free of charge.

Comparing costs throughout multiple specialists in your area can reveal substantial variation. Nevertheless, the cheapest option is not constantly the most proper-- ensuring that a professional has pertinent certifications and experience for your particular issues is critical.

Often Asked Questions

For how long does a personal psychological health assessment take?

The duration varies based upon the type of assessment and its intricacy. An uncomplicated preliminary assessment generally lasts 60 to 90 minutes. Comprehensive psychological assessments may need two to 4 hours spread throughout several sessions. Complex evaluations for conditions like ADHD or autism often include six to ten hours overall, including screening, interviews, and report writing.

Can I get an NHS referral for a private assessment?

The NHS does not typically fund personal psychological health assessments directly. However, some NHS trusts have plans with personal providers that allow patients to select private assessment with NHS financing in particular situations, particularly for conditions with long NHS waiting lists. Speaking to your GP can clarify whether any such plans use in your area.

What certifications should I look for in a private professional?

Ensure any specialist you consult is correctly signed up with the pertinent professional body. Clinical psychologists need to be signed up with the Health and Care Professions Council, while psychiatrists need to be on the General Medical Council professional register. Counsellors and psychotherapists may be registered with bodies such as the British Association for Counselling and Psychotherapy.

Is a private diagnosis identified by the NHS?

Yes, diagnoses made by appropriately certified private professionals are typically acknowledged by NHS services. Private psychological health assessments in the UK represent a substantial financial commitment, with costs ranging from around ₤ 300 for fundamental evaluations to over ₤ 1,500 for thorough neuropsychological assessments. While these costs might seem substantial, many individuals discover that the much faster access, greater flexibility, and choice of practitioner justify the financial investment, especially when psychological health symptoms substantially affect daily functioning.

Eventually, the decision to pursue private assessment should balance practical factors to consider of cost and timing with the value of finding a certified specialist who can provide precise diagnosis and reliable treatment assistance.
